About Augustine Thompson

Augustine Thompson is a scholar working on Religious studies, History, Classics, Information Systems and General Arts and Humanities, having authored 12 papers that have together received 92 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Theology and Canon Law Studies (3 papers), Medieval Literature and History (2 papers), Early Modern Women Writers (1 paper), Byzantine Studies and History (1 paper), Medieval Philosophy and Theology (1 paper), Classical Studies and Legal History (1 paper), Historical and Religious Studies of Rome (1 paper) and Historical Studies of British Isles (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Classics (48 citations), History (58 citations), Religious studies (14 citations), Philosophy (20 citations) and History and Philosophy of Science (4 citations). Augustine Thompson has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include George Dameron, James Gordley and Daniel Bornstein. Their work appears in journals such as The American Historical Review, English Language Notes, Journal of the history of philosophy, Cornell University Press eBooks and Project Muse (Johns Hopkins University).
